Output 45844bb4376dfa3f81844f7e9fb33564c2cc549e42e6da6e7a1d73c615eff76b:28

value
29708143
script pubkey
OP_0 OP_PUSHBYTES_20 dfa22d43b66ba491a9cda4a231881035d0186ea9
address
ltc1qm73z6sakdwjfr2wd5j3rrzqsxhgpsm4fyfn9y4
transaction
45844bb4376dfa3f81844f7e9fb33564c2cc549e42e6da6e7a1d73c615eff76b
spent
true